Grouding stsrem is the most crucial area in power system network. Poor grounding system can be dangerous to the users and wire of the electrical distribution system in the event of electrical fault. To prevent this accident, it is very important to have a good grounding system to protect the systems well as to the user. Therefore, this paper measures the grounding resistance with two planted electrode designs with two different conductive compound using Driven Rod method with the help of equipment earth testers. The experimental works was conducted in two medium of conductive compound which is graphite and bentonite using standard and three branches copper rod. The experimental results show that the copper rod with conductive compound suitable to replace the standard copper rod since the measured grounding resistance is the lowest. It is also proven that the three branches copper rod exhibits better value of soil resistaivity which can be used for the grounding system.
